Becoming a medical assistant can be an extremely versatile and rewarding job. Medical assistants are indispensable to keeping a medical office running smoothly. One of the main components of the position is performing administrative tasks, such as scheduling patients' upcoming appointments and ensuring all necessary paperwork is completed. Other times, medical assistants can complete more clinical duties, such as taking a patient's blood pressure and other vital stats, confirming a patient's medical history, or providing clarification on medicines and tests ordered by the physician.
